How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fort Mill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fort Mill Studio Apartments | $1,478 | $1,035 | $2,189 |
| Fort Mill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,488 | $919 | $3,837 |
| Fort Mill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,810 | $1,115 | $4,669 |
| Fort Mill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,135 | $1,429 | $5,845 |
| Fort Mill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,800 | $2,800 | $2,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Mill Apartments with Washer/Dryer
How much is the average rent for Fort Mill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Fort Mill with Washer/Dryer is $2,001.
What is the largest Fort Mill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Fort Mill is a 2,739 square feet unit starting from $2,447 at Townhomes at Bridlestone.
What is the average size for Fort Mill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Fort Mill is currently at 755 sq ft.
